‘Big Tech’ Hiring Declined for Class of 2023 MBA Graduates

Tech jobs have been a popular choice for MBA candidates since the early 2000s – gradually becoming one of the top three career paths that many business school graduates pursue (along with consulting and finance). M7 Business Schools Continue to Dominate in Venture Capital and Private Equity Finance Careers

MBA graduates continue to be drawn to careers in the finance industry due to the large compensation packages, the chance to work on high-profile deals at investment banks, and the opportunity to invest in the next billion-dollar company at a venture capital or private equity firm. Real Numbers of MBA Admissions: Percentage of Women MBA Students

Over the past decade, the percentage of women MBA students has been on the rise across leading business schools. USC Marshall was the first leading business school to achieve gender parity while others have achieved or continue to strive for that benchmark.
